About Marc Lopez
Marc Lopez is a scholar working on Immunology, Epidemiology, Cardiology and Cardiovascular Medicine, Molecular Biology and Oncology, having authored 70 papers that have together received 5.2k indexed citations. Recurring topics across this work include Immune Cell Function and Interaction (15 papers), Herpesvirus Infections and Treatments (14 papers), Viral Infections and Immunology Research (14 papers), T-cell and B-cell Immunology (11 papers), Vector-Borne Animal Diseases (9 papers), Wnt/β-catenin signaling in development and cancer (6 papers), Toxin Mechanisms and Immunotoxins (6 papers) and Galectins and Cancer Biology (5 papers). The work is most often cited by research in Immunology (2.1k citations), Epidemiology (1.7k citations), Immunology and Allergy (284 citations), Hematology (401 citations) and Oncology (834 citations). Marc Lopez has collaborated with scholars based in France, Italy and United States. Frequent co-authors include Patrice Dubreuil, Gabriella Campadelli‐Fiume, Laura Menotti, Francesca Cocchi, Nicolas Reymond, Stéphanie Fabre, Alessandro Moretta, Claudia Cantoni, José Adélaı̈de and Cristina Bottino. Their work appears in journals such as Journal of Virology, Blood, European Journal of Immunology, Gene and Journal of Biological Chemistry.
